BMW 6 series Gran Coupé, F06 (USA)

Transfer case fluid capacity & service interval

BMW 6 series Gran Coupé, F06 (USA) transfer case fluid capacity ranges from 0,44 to 0,62 liters. The data covers 4 configurations.

TypeSpecifications
640i xDrive Gran Coupé (2015-2018)
  • Use: Normal
  • Capacity 0,62 liter (Dry fill)
  • Capacity 0,44 liter (Service fill)
  • Code: ATC 35L
650i xDrive Gran Coupé (2015-2018)
  • Use: Normal
  • Capacity 0,62 liter (Dry fill)
  • Capacity 0,44 liter (Service fill)
640i xDrive Gran Coupé (2013-2015)
  • Use: Normal
  • Capacity 0,62 liter (Dry fill)
  • Capacity 0,44 liter (Service fill)
  • Code: ATC 35L
650i xDrive Gran Coupé (2012-2015)
  • Use: Normal
  • Capacity 0,62 liter (Dry fill)
  • Capacity 0,44 liter (Service fill)

Additional Notes

  • The BMW 6 Series Gran Coupé F06 transfer case carries a dry fill capacity of 0.62 liter across all listed xDrive configurations. A dry fill figure represents the total fluid volume required when filling a completely empty or freshly rebuilt unit, such as after a full overhaul or replacement.
  • The service fill capacity is 0.44 liter for every listed configuration, which is the amount used during a routine fluid change where residual fluid remains in the unit after draining. The gap between the 0.62-liter dry fill and the 0.44-liter service fill reflects that retained volume.
